Transaction fdbec8c4f77672e43a900c59660e2331b181173de375100813639476c483c3e7
1 Input
1 Output
-
fdbec8c4f77672e43a900c59660e2331b181173de375100813639476c483c3e7:0
- value
- 165753739
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 527b4bce2df2db487cab6798ef9175501cc11346 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18X87VfwurPQX1CeTj8rmQ9dj5XPJ7cXxj